1-(3-benzyl-1H-indol-2-yl)-2-methoxyethanone
Also Known As: 1-Benzyl-2-(methoxyacetyl)indole, Methoxymethyl 3-benzyl-2-indolyl ketone, KETONE, METHOXYMETHYL 3-BENZYL-2-INDOLYL, 1-(3-benzyl-1H-indol-2-yl)-2-methoxyethan-1-one, Methoxymethyl(3-benzyl-1H-indol-2-yl) ketone
| Molecular Formula | C18H17NO2 |
| Molecular Weight | 279.12592 g/mol |
| XLogP | 3.9 |
| Topological Polar Surface Area (TPSA) | 42.1 Ų |
| Hydrogen Bond Donors | 1 |
| Hydrogen Bond Acceptors | 2 |
| Rotatable Bonds | 5 |
| Exact Mass | 279.12592 Da |
| Heavy Atoms | 21 |
| Complexity | 351.0 |
| SMILES | COCC(=O)C1=C(C2=CC=CC=C2N1)CC3=CC=CC=C3 |
| InChIKey | AEGFGVNUWOUJCM-UHFFFAOYSA-N |
The XLogP value of 3.9 indicates that Ketone, methoxymethyl 3-benzyl-2-indolyl is lipophilic (fat-soluble), which may influence its absorption, distribution, and formulation strategy. With a topological polar surface area (TPSA) of 42.1 Ų, Ketone, methoxymethyl 3-benzyl-2-indolyl exhibits relatively low polarity, potentially indicating favorable cell membrane permeability. Following Lipinski's Rule of Five, Ketone, methoxymethyl 3-benzyl-2-indolyl has 1 hydrogen bond donor(s) and 2 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
